arrow_back Back to main guideThis is the main area to stay, close to the temple and the start of the trek. Expect basic accommodation and a religious atmosphere. It's best for trekkers and pilgrims.
Best For: Trekkers and Pilgrims
Located about 150km away, Mangalore offers a wider range of accommodation options, including luxury hotels. It's a good option if you prefer a more urban environment. However, it requires a significant commute to Kukke Subramanya.
Best For: Travelers seeking luxury and urban amenities

A spicy rice and lentil dish cooked with vegetables and tamarind (try at local restaurants)
Sweet, fluffy fried bread made from maida flour, banana, and sugar (try at local restaurants)
